Your spirit which has gone afar to the highest mountains, may it return to you again that it may live and dwell here.

Rig Veda X, 58, 9

Your spirit which has gone afar to the whole world, may it return to you again that it may live and dwell here.

Rig Veda X, 58, 10

He who knows what has the attribute of procreation (prajati) is enriched with children and animals. Semen verily has this attribute. He who knows this is enriched with children and animals.

Yajur Veda, Brihadaranyaka Upanishad VI, I-The Supremacy of the Prana, 6

These organs, disputing about who was superior among them, went to Prajapati and asked: Which one among us is the most excellent (vasishtha)? He said: That one among you is the most excellent by whose departure this body is considered to suffer most.

Yajur Veda, Brihadaranyaka Upanishad VI, I-The Supremacy of the Prana, 7

May the Wind, Lord of the middle air, protect me in this my prayer, in this my act, in this my priestly duty, in this my performance, in this my thought, in this my purpose and desire, in this my calling on the Gods! All Hail!

Atharva Veda V, 24, 8
